Weather in May

May, the last month of the spring in Lagoi, is another hot month, with temperature in the range of an average low of 27.5°C (81.5°F) and an average high of 31.6°C (88.9°F).

Temperature

In Lagoi, May is identified by the highest average temperatures, reaching a peak of 31.6°C (88.9°F) and a low of 27.5°C (81.5°F).

Heat index

The heat index value for May is calculated to be a blistering 40°C (104°F). Adopt additional preventive measures, heat cramps and heat exhaustion are potential outcomes. Prolonged activity may trigger heatstroke.
It is noted that heat index values are ascertained for locations in the shade and with gentle breezes. The heat index values could be amplified by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ees in direct sunlight.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'felt air temperature', unifies temperature and humidity readings to offer a comprehensive feel of warmth. A person's impression of weather can be affected by numerous aspects, among them metabolic variations, pregnancy, and activity levels. When in direct sunlight, one should be cautious as it can raise the heat index by as much as 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are particularly important for children. Children often overlook the need for breaks and fluid intake. Thirst is a late-stage sign of dehydration - hence, it is necessary to stay hydrated, especially during extended periods of physical activities.
Normally, the human body cools itself through perspiration, which removes excessive heat by evaporating sweat. Increased relative humidity slows down evaporation, thereby decreasing the rate of heat removal from the body, culminating in a sensation of overheating. Heat-related challenges, like dehydration, can be anticipated when body heat isn't managed effectively.

Humidity

In May, the average relative humidity is 73%.

Rainfall

In Lagoi, in May, it is raining for 22.5 days, with typically 78mm (3.07") of accumulated precipitation. In Lagoi, during the entire year, the rain falls for 250.2 days and collects up to 920mm (36.22") of precipitation.

Sea temperature

May and June, with an average sea temperature of 30°C (86°F), are months with the warmest seawater.
Note: Seeking solace in water that's above 30°C (86°F) in temperature might not provide the anticipated relief from the heat.

Daylight

In May, the average length of the day is 12h and 10min.
On the first day of May, sunrise is at 05:54 and sunset at 18:04.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 05:54 and sunset at 18:05 WIB.

Sunshine

The month with the most sunshine is May, with an average of 10.7h of sunshine.

UV index

January through November, with an average maximum UV index of 7, are months with the highest UV index. A UV Index reading of 6 to 7 represents a high threat to health from exposure to the Sun's UV radiation for the average person.
Note: In May, the average maximum UV index of 7 translates into the following recommendations:
Shun overexposure. Protection from sun ravages is indispensable. To the best of your ability, limit your exposure to the sun between the hours of 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., when UV radiation is at its peak. For a sun-safe wardrobe, go for clothes that are tightly woven and generously sized. Alert! The Sun's UV rays are heightened by the reflection of sand and water.
